Algebra — practice question

The polynomial $p(x)$ is specified as $p(x) = ax^3 - 3x^2 - 5x + a + 4$, where $a$ is constant.
(i)[2]

Since $(x - 2)$ is a factor of $p(x)$, determine the value of $a$.

(ii(a))[3]

With this value of $a$, factorise $p(x)$ fully.

(ii(b))[2]

Determine the remainder when $p(x)$ is divided by $(x + 1)$.
